What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Ochelata, Oklahoma?

In Ochelata, Oklahoma,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,000 to $4,500, depending on the level of care, room type (private vs. semi-private), and specific amenities offered. This is generally lower than the national average and reflects Oklahoma's overall more affordable cost of living. It's important to note that as a smaller town, Ochelata may have fewer facilities than larger cities, so costs can vary. Always request a detailed breakdown of what is included in the base rate versus additional care fees.

Are there any assisted living facilities directly in Ochelata, OK, and how can I find them?

Ochelata is a very small town, so it's common for residents to look at facilities in nearby communities within Washington County or the broader Bartlesville area. There may not be a large, dedicated assisted living facility within Ochelata's immediate city limits. The best way to find local options is to contact the Oklahoma Department of Human Services Aging Services Division for a licensed provider list in Washington County, use online senior care directories filtered for the 74051 zip code, or consult with a local senior placement advisor familiar with rural Oklahoma options in towns like Bartlesville, Dewey, or Nowata which serve the Ochelata area.

What types of services and amenities are typically offered in assisted living communities serving Ochelata residents?

Assisted living communities in the area serving Ochelata typically offer 24-hour staff assistance, medication management, housekeeping, laundry, and meals. Many also provide social and recreational activities, transportation for medical appointments and local errands (which is crucial in rural areas), and basic health monitoring. Given Ochelata's location, some facilities might offer a more residential, community-focused environment. Amenities can vary, so it's important to ask about specific offerings like outdoor spaces, family visitation areas, and any partnerships with local healthcare providers in Washington County.

How are assisted living facilities regulated and licensed in Oklahoma, and what should I look for?

In Oklahoma,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the Oklahoma State Department of Health (OSDH) under the Residential Care Act. Facilities must meet specific standards for safety, staffing, and care. When evaluating a facility for an Ochelata resident, you should verify its current license status with OSDH, review recent inspection reports for any deficiencies, and ensure it has proper emergency plans—important in a state prone to severe weather. Also, confirm the facility's policy on care plan assessments and how they handle transitions to higher levels of care, as access to skilled nursing may require travel to a larger town.

What local resources in Washington County, OK, can help families with the transition to assisted living?

Families in Ochelata can utilize several local and state resources. The Oklahoma Department of Human Services Aging Services Division for Washington County can provide information on programs like ADvantage Waiver, which may offer financial assistance for eligible seniors. The Bartlesville Senior Center and Area Agency on Aging for Northeast Oklahoma (based in Tulsa) offer counseling, support groups, and educational resources. Additionally, consulting with an elder law attorney in Bartlesville can help with financial and legal planning. For veterans, the Oklahoma Department of Veterans Affairs can clarify potential benefits. Local hospitals, like Ascension St. John Jane Phillips in Bartlesville, may also have social workers who can provide referrals.

Veteran-Focused Assisted Living Options in Ochelata

For families in Ochelata and the surrounding Washington County area, finding the right assisted living for a veteran loved one is a journey that blends deep respect for their service with the practical needs of daily care. It’s a search that goes beyond just a facility; it’s about finding a community that understands the unique life experiences and potential benefits available to those who served. The good news is that Oklahoma has a strong network of support for its aging veterans, and with some focused research, you can find a supportive and comfortable home nearby.

A crucial first step is understanding the specific financial assistance programs for veterans. The VA Aid and Attendance benefit is a vital resource that many families are unaware of. This pension supplement can significantly help cover the costs of assisted living for veterans who require help with daily activities like bathing, dressing, or medication management. To navigate this, connecting with a Veterans Service Officer (VSO) is invaluable. You can find one through the Washington County courthouse or the Oklahoma Department of Veterans Affairs. They provide free, expert assistance in compiling military records, medical evidence, and completing the application, ensuring your loved one receives every benefit they have earned.

When touring assisted living communities near Ochelata, perhaps in Bartlesville, Pawhuska, or Tulsa, it’s important to ask questions that go beyond the standard checklist. Inquire directly about their experience with veteran residents. Do they have staff trained to recognize signs of PTSD or understand military culture? Are there social groups or activities that foster camaraderie among veterans? Many communities in Oklahoma proudly display their appreciation, hosting flag ceremonies on patriotic holidays or facilitating connections with local VFW or American Legion chapters. This sense of shared identity can be profoundly comforting and ease the transition into community living.
